Buying Guide: Thermal Binoculars With Rangefinder

What to consider when choosing a thermal binocular with a rangefinder:

  • Sensor resolution and NETD: Higher resolution (e.g., 384×288) and lower NETD (under 20 mK) yield clearer heat signatures, especially in challenging conditions.
  • Rangefinder range: Longer measurement capability (up to 1,800 m or more) supports better distance assessment for distant targets.
  • Multispectral capability: Day, Night, Twilight, and Thermal modes add versatility across lighting and weather scenarios.
  • Field of view and optics: Consider lens size (e.g., 25 mm vs 50 mm) and zoom range to balance detection distance with image brightness and edge clarity.
  • Ruggedness and water resistance: IP ratings and robust housing matter for outdoor or duty use.
  • Image stabilization: Helps maintain a steady image during movement or at higher magnifications.
  • Storage and data capture: Built-in recording and memory capacity can be important for documentation and review.
  • Weight and ergonomics: Heavier models deliver more capability but may reduce comfort for extended wear.

FAQs

  1. What is the benefit of a laser rangefinder in thermal binos?

    It provides precise distance data to targets, improving range estimation and aiming decisions in the field.
  2. Which thermal binocular is best for hunting at night?

    Look for models with strong low-light performance, a comfortable fit, and a reliable 1,000 m LRF for long-range shots.
  3. How important is thermal sensor resolution?

    Higher resolution (e.g., 384×288) improves detail and target discrimination, especially through brush or fog.
  4. Should I prioritize IP rating or thermal sensitivity?

    Both matter; IP ratings protect against weather, while sensitivity determines heat-detection quality.
  5. Can these devices record footage?

    Some models include built-in recording; check memory capacity if you need to store video or photos.
